If you want to build anything with GameMaker above the level of a Breakout clone, youre going to have to learn to code a little. But I highly recommend going that route anyway. If youre just a hobbyist or game tinkerer, dont spend the years and years learning the ins and outs of a programming language. Use a game creator to test your ideas out. Once youre sure you have a good game on your hands, THEN learn a programming language to fully code your game.
